Crystallization and microstructure development of Si2N4-Ti(C, N)-Y2O3 ceramics derived from chemically modified perhydropolysilazane

[Si-Y-Ti-O-C-N] multicomponent amorphous powders were synthesized by pyrolysis at 1000 degreesC, in NH3 flow, of chemically modified perhydropolysilazane using Y(OCH(CH3)(2))(3) and Ti(N(CH3)(2))(4). The [Si-Y-Ti-O-C-N] powders were fully crystallized to yield Ti(C, N) nano/micro particle-dispersed beta -Si3N4Y2O3 ceramics by hot pressing at 1800 degreesC in N-2. The resulting ceramics exhibited a uniform and fine-grained microstructure. Titanium in the [Si-Y-Ti-O-C-N] powders could act as a catalyst to accelerate alpha-/beta Si3N4 phase transformation as well as an in-situ source for nano/micro Ti(C, N) particles, which lead to microstructural uniformity and grain refinement of beta -Si3N4-Ti(C, N)-Y2O3 ceramics.
